Question: Why are my Facebook forms not appearing in the LeadMagicX?**
**Answer: This may be due to a connection issue. To refresh the connection, try re-selecting your Facebook page using the provided URL.
Question: What should I do if the connection page keeps spinning?**
**Answer: Ensure you are logged in under the applicable domain. Also, check for any browser or network issues that might affect connectivity.
Question: How can I test if my lead ads are working correctly?**
**Answer: Use the Facebook Lead Ads Testing Tool to create test leads and verify the payload status for successful integration.
Question: What if my test leads are not showing up in the LeadMagicX?**
**Answer: Check the app ID and permissions in the Facebook Business Manager. If necessary, re-add the app and ensure all permissions are correctly set.

Question: How can I fix incorrect or missing form field mappings in Facebook Lead Ads?**
**Answer: If the form field mappings are incorrect or missing, go to the Facebook form field mapping section in LeadMagicX, ensure that the forms are mapped, and set their status to active. If the forms don’t appear, follow the troubleshooting steps to refresh the connection and re-select your Facebook page.

Question: How can I verify the technical “payload status” of my Facebook leads?
Answer: Use the Facebook Lead Ads Testing Tool to create a test lead and check for a “success (200)” status. If you see error codes instead, the connection is not working properly.
